Barack Obama Clarifies 'Snappy Slogans' Remark on 'The Daily Show' | THR News
Barack Obama Clarifies "Snappy Slogans" Remark on 'The Daily Show' | THR News

Barack Obama responded to criticism of his remark that political candidates risk losing support when they turn to "snappy slogans" like "defund the police" during an appearance on 'The Daily Show' with host Trevor Noah on Tuesday night.